TARZAN

Two weeks ago our 3rd and 4th of primary students watched a theatre play, Tarzan.

Tarzan lives in the jungle in Africa. He has a lot of friends. His best friend is a monkey called Cheetah. Tarzan likes living in the jungle. He is very happy. Jane is a photographer. She lives in London but today she is in the jungle. She wants to take photographs of monkeys. Jane is travelling with a guide called Clayton. He is not a nice person. He is a hunter. He is also an expert on surviving in the jungle. Jane doesn’t know that Clayton’s favourite food is monkey!
One day Tarzan and Jane meet in the jungle. Tarzan likes Jane and Jane likes Tarzan. But Jane doesn’t like Tarzan’s smell! Tarzan never washes his body, cleans his teeth or combs his hair! So, Tarzan needs help from his animal friends. He needs to learn about personal hygiene. The elephant teaches him to wash his body. The crocodile teaches him to clean his teeth. The lion teaches him to comb his hair. Meanwhile, someone needs to teach Clayton that killing animals for fun is not nice! 

After watching the play they created a comic explaining the story with some pictures and English sentences. Here you have some of them.

THE GOONIES

This week our 6th of primary students watched 'The Goonies'. It is a 1985 American adventure-comedy film directed by Richard Donner.

The Goonies are a crazy bunch of misfit kids whose only hope of saving their neighbourhood from greedy developers who want to use the area to build a new golf course, is to find the lost treasure of a 17th Century pirate.

WE LIKE AUTUMN AND WINTER

This week our 3rd of primary students have started an eTwinning project about autumn and winter. It consists of making and sharing some cultural and personal work with other countries. Concretely, in this project the countries involved are: Ireland, Czech Republic, Romania, Greece, Slovakia, Poland, Lithuania and Spain.

This week students created a logo about autumn and winter in small groups and they have voted for the best logo in their classroom. English teachers chose one of them to send it to the other countries. They were very motivated.
